So there have been a couple runs of rubber MOS glyphs/emblems/shields, one from Kapow7, designed by DIStudios, and another which was a collaboration by BigGeek and Bimmer. I bought the Biggeek glyph, but I want to have a full front shirt portion of the suit for a "reveal" version of the costume to wear to opening night ("reveal" as in only the front torso of the suit showing beneath a pulled open button-down shirt.

So the hunt was on for a blue shirt to affix the glyph to and apply the chainmail pattern to. I found one tonight. Haynes has a "Mountain Blue" color heavy-weight (what they call their "Beefy-T" line) shirt that looks to my eye to be an almost exact match to the actual blue-gray color of the suit. I got mine at Wal-Mart for only $5. I wear Medium and Large shirts normally but since I want this to be skin tight I bought a small. It's almost too tight so I may have to get a Medium after all. I plan on applying the chain mail pattern and additional striping details near the waist using either puffy paint or Plasti-dip.

I gave up on trying to puffy-paint the chainmail pattern. It's just too small for me to be able to do it without a stencil. I did paint the shield, but it's packed up now from just moving.
